Signs Your Tree Needs Attention in Anchorage
Anchorage’s climate tests trees with heavy winter storms, saturated soils from melt, and dry, sun-exposed summers. Coastal winds, occasional salt spray near the inlet, and urban lot conditions—compacted soil, irrigation extremes, and heat islands—amplify stress on even otherwise healthy trees. Early warning signs matter here because saturated winter soils can fail limbs suddenly, and windstorms can topple weak trees or pop branches that look “okay” during a calm spell. By watching for the indicators below, you can head off bigger problems before they become costly or dangerous.
In Anchorage, a few warning signs are especially telling due to our environment. Quick-fading vigor, unusual wood or bark changes, and patterns of dieback in species common to our yards often point to root, structural, or pest issues that the local climate will aggravate if left unchecked.
General Red Flags for Any Tree
- Dead, dying, or thinning branches in the crown, especially on one side or in the lower canopy
- Cracks or splits in the trunk or major limbs, or a visibly cracked or hollow trunk
- A trunk or leaning tree that appears to tilt more than a typical lean, or shows movement in wind
- Exposed roots, heaving soil at the base, or a pronounced mulch volcano that’s too high against the trunk
- Fungal growth at the base, on the trunk, or on exposed roots (mushrooms, brackets, or white/yellowish mycelium)
- Cavities, hollow sections, or soft, spongy wood when the limb or trunk is probed
- Sudden changes in color or vigor (new shoots failing to leaf out, or a crown that suddenly pale or brown)
- Bark peeling away in patches or unusually smooth patches on mature trunks
How this looks in Anchorage: if you see these signs after a winter thaw or a windy spell, the risk of limb failure increases, particularly on trees with shallow roots or compacted soils.

Pest and Disease Signs to Watch For Locally
- Spruce bark beetle and related pests: pitch tubes (tiny sap beads) on the trunk, fine exit holes, crown thinning with yellow-to-orange needles, and a general rapid decline in a previously healthy spruce
- Armillaria root rot (honey fungus): white mycelial networks under loose bark near the base, stringy rhizomorphs (“shoestrings”) at the root crown, and honey-colored mushrooms at the base in wetter years
- Aphids, scales, and other sap-feeders: sticky honeydew on leaves and branches, curling or distorted foliage, and sooty mold growth on branches
- Rusts and cankers: localized cankers on the trunk or branches with unusual discolored bark, small spore deposits, or fruiting bodies; leaves showing yellowing, spotting, or premature drop

Average Costs for Tree Services in Anchorage
Tree service costs in Anchorage are driven by a mix of local labor rates, equipment access in hilly or waterfront lots, disposal fees, seasonal demand, permit requirements, and the prevalence of tall conifers. Weather patterns, windstorms, and frozen ground seasons also push pricing up during peak windows. In practice, you'll pay more for difficult access (steep driveways, rocky slopes, or dense evergreen stands) and for services that require cranes, rope rigging, or special safety measures. Disposal fees at local facilities and the cost of fuel and travel can also influence the final bill. The numbers below are realistic 2025-2026 ranges you’ll typically see for Anchorage-area jobs and are averages—actual quotes can vary widely.
Typical Cost Ranges for Tree Trimming and Pruning
- Small pruning or light limb removal (ground level access, up to ~15 ft): $150–$350 per tree.
- Medium pruning (15–40 ft, more limbs, some thinning): $350–$900 per tree.
- Large pruning (40–80 ft, structural work, tighter crown access): $900–$1,900 per tree.
- Very tall or complex pruning (over 80 ft, crane/rigger work): $2,000–$5,000+ per tree.
- Note: Some crews charge by the hour (roughly $85–$125/hour in Anchorage) plus disposal, so a small job may come in closer to the lower end if it’s straightforward.
Tree Removal Costs by Size and Complexity
- Small trees (<30 ft): $300–$800 per tree, depending on trunk diameter and access.
- Medium trees (30–60 ft): $900–$2,500 per tree, with steeper terrain or restricted access pushing higher.
- Large trees (>60 ft) or hazardous removals: $2,500–$6,000+, especially if rigging, cranes, or arborist climbers are required.
- Storm-damage or emergency removals: often 1.5×–2× normal rates, plus potential after-storm cleanup charges.
Stump Grinding and Removal
- Per-inch diameter pricing: roughly $3–$6 per inch, with a $100–$150 minimum per stump.
- Typical residential stumps: $100–$300 per stump for small to moderate stumps (6–12 inches).
- Larger stumps (18–24 inches): $250–$400.
- Very large stumps (>30 inches): $400–$800 or more, depending on access and finish depth.
Additional Fees and Add-Ons
- Debris disposal/haul-away: $75–$150 per load; some crews include disposal in the job, others itemize it separately.
- Wood chipping or mulch service: included in some quotes; otherwise $0–$60 per cubic yard if you need mulch delivered or left on-site.
- Equipment access surcharges: hillside, steep driveways, or restricted spaces can add 10%–40% to the base price.
- Permits and regulatory fees: $50–$500 depending on jurisdictional requirements and whether a permit is needed for removals near utilities or protected trees.
- Travel or service-area fees: minor distances may be free; longer distances in outer neighborhoods or coastal zones may add $25–$75.
- Hidden risks: damage from improper work can lead to more costs if not covered by a reputable provider; always ensure insurance and warranties are clear.

Aftercare and Long-Term Tree Maintenance in Anchorage
Proper aftercare matters here because Anchorage’s climate and soils present unique recovery challenges. Wet winters and thaw cycles can slow wound healing from pruning or removals, while hot, dry summers stress trees that have been opened up or damaged. Soils range from heavy clay to sandy textures, and coastal sites may expose trees to salt spray and strong winds. Understanding these local patterns helps your trees regain strength, grow safely, and resist pests and disease over the long haul.
Immediate Post-Trimming or Removal Care
- Inspect all cuts for clean edges and remove ragged bark or torn tissue with clean cuts. For large, structural pruning or removals, consider professional evaluation to avoid hazardous bark faults.
- Do not rely on wound dressings, paints, or tar. In most situations they don’t speed healing and can trap moisture or pathogens. Let the wound callus naturally.
- Keep the area tidy: remove broken branches and avoid piling debris directly against the trunk to prevent fungal growth.
- Protect the trunk and fresh wounds from mechanical damage, pets, and heavy traffic. If you have waterfront or windy property, shield exposed limbs from wind whip and salt spray as the tree begins recovery.
- Watch for signs of sudden decline in the first growing season (wilting, rapid leaf drop, unusual cankers). If you see concerning symptoms, consult a certified arborist.
Watering Guidelines for Local Conditions
- Anchorage trees recover best with deep, infrequent irrigation that soaks the root zone rather than daily surface watering. In dry spells, aim to moisten the root zone to a depth of 12–18 inches and extend watering to the drip line when possible.
- Adjust for soil type: clay soils drain slowly and hold moisture longer; sandy soils drain quickly and dry out faster. Use soil-moisture awareness to guide frequency.
- Water early in the day to reduce evaporation and disease pressure. On salt-exposed or windy waterfront sites, water more during dry spells but avoid wetting the trunk collar excessively.
- Avoid overwatering, which invites root rot in our clay-heavy beds and can promote fungal issues after pruning. If you’re unsure, use a moisture meter or consult a local extension resource.
- For newly planted or recently pruned trees, maintain consistent moisture through the first full growing season, then taper as the tree establishes.
Mulching and Soil Health
- Apply 2–4 inches of organic mulch around the root zone, extending to the drip line where feasible. Keep mulch 2–3 inches away from the trunk to prevent collar rot and rodent damage.
- Refresh mulch annually and mulch depth as needed to maintain uniform moisture buffering. Avoid volcano mulch, which can suffocate roots and trap moisture against the trunk.
- Use local compost or leaf mold where available to boost soil biology, but test soil pH and nutrient levels if you’re unsure. Anchorage’s soils can vary widely; a quick test through your extension service or a local soil lab helps tailor amendments.
